Web1 dag geleden · While Crane doesn’t break out individual municipal high-yielders, one well-known standout is Fidelity Municipal Money Market ( FTEXX ), Howard’s Stark says. … Web9 nov. 2024 · Note the difference between a money market account and a money market fund. The two are not interchangeable. A money market account is a high-yield savings account that is insured by the FDIC for up to $250,000 and holds money for future investing. A money market fund is an investment that holds short-term securities and …

WebMoney Market Funds are debt funds that lend to companies for a period of up to 1 year. These Funds are designed in a manner that allows the fund manager to generate higher returns while keeping risk under control through adjustment of lending duration. Higher loan tenure usually comes with higher returns.
